ZEE5, a prominent home-grown video streaming platform in India, has unveiled the poster for its upcoming original series, ‘Gyaarah Gyaarah’, sparking intrigue with the launch date set as August 9 1990. This peculiar date has left fans speculating about the show’s unique premise and how it relates to the past.
Co-produced by the multihyphenate Karan Johar and Apoorva Mehta of Dharmatic Entertainment, and Oscar-winning filmmaker duo Guneet Monga Kapoor and Achin Jain of Sikhya Entertainment, Gyaarah Gyaarah is directed by Umesh Bist.
The series is a police drama set in Uttarakhand, featuring two officers from different eras linked by a mysterious walkie-talkie. This device triggers a butterfly effect, impacting events in both the past and present, blending sci-fi with intense drama.
Commenting on the series, Manish Kalra, Chief Business Officer at ZEE5, “We’re excited to partner with industry leaders like Sikhya Entertainment and Dharmatic Entertainment. ‘Gyaarah Gyaarah’ promises to be a groundbreaking addition to our content library, blending sci-fi, mystery, and drama.”
‘Gyaarah Gyaarah’ will be available exclusively on ZEE5, reaching over 190 countries. Prepare for a thrilling exploration of time and justice with this highly anticipated series.
